About This Item

London: George Allen & Unwin Ltd, 1930. First UK edition. 8vo, 312pp. Illustrations throughout. Presentation copy, inscribed by Shepard to Robert W. Gordon on the ffep. Red cloth lettered in blind on front cover and gilt on spine, top edge stained red. Minor wear to boards, light foxing to page block edge and endpapers. Near fine.

Inscribed first edition of this important work on unicorns, exploring in depth their appearance in legend and literature, including in the bible, over the centuries.  Odell Shepard (1884-1967) was a writer, professor, and Lieutenant Governor of Connecticut.  In 1938 he won the Pulitzer Prize for his Pedlar's Progress: The Life of Bronson Alcott.  

This copy inscribed to his college friend at Harvard, and later, colleague at the University of California, Robert W. Gordon (1888-1961).  Gordon was an important figure in the preservation and study of American Folk-Song.
